Citrusdal Golf Club
Golf club in orange country
Citrusdal Golf Club has a nine-hole course situated in the beautiful fruit-growing town. It’s quite flat and a relatively easy one to play for most players. The course was conceived when in 1960 a group of 15 local men decided to build a golf course at the common ground known locally as the “Koeikamp.”The men worked hard and succeeded in building a 4-hole course, but the upkeep proved too much and it ran into disrepair. In 1975 the “Koeikamp” golf area was renovated and 9 holes were completed.
Currently, Citrusdal Golf Club is 5264 metres of parkland with a par of 70 and is one of the best 9-hole golf courses in the Western Cape. It is on the banks of the Olifants River and is very level with magnificent views of the majestic Cederberg Mountains.
